Before you can uninstall Cluster Server from a node, perform the following steps:
1. Take all resource groups off-line or move them to the other node.
2. Evict the node from the cluster by right-clicking the node icon in Cluster
Administrator and selecting Evict Node from the menu.
3. Close Cluster Administrator on the node.
4. Stop the Cluster Service running on the node.
5. Uninstall Microsoft Cluster Server using the Add/Remove Programs utility in
the Control Panel.

When removing a node from a cluster, you must power down the node before remov-
ing any of the cluster cabling. Likewise, when rejoining a node to a cluster, attach all
cables before starting the node.

A quorum resource is typically a hard-disk drive in the shared storage subsystem that
serves the following two purposes in a cluster system:
Acts as an arbiter between the two nodes to ensure that the specific data neces-
sary for system recovery is maintained consistently across the nodes
Logs the recovery data sent by the nodes
Only one node can control the quorum resource at one time, and it is that node that
remains running when the two nodes are unable to communicate with each other.
Once the two nodes are unable to communicate, the Cluster Service automatically
shuts down the node that does not own the quorum resource.
With one of the nodes shut down, changes to the cluster configuration database are
logged to the quorum disk. The purpose of this logging is to ensure that the node that
gains control of the quorum disk has access to an up-to-date version of the cluster
configuration database.
